Highlights from Recent Projects
Cheryl Loh, a freelance graphic designer, was hired by the Vancouver Fraser Port Authority to develop social media graphics, infographics for print and website, and other marketing materials. The aim was to create engaging and eye-catching materials that simplified complex information. Cheryl was chosen for her ability to adapt her illustrations to various corporate clients and their overall brand look and feel. She collaborated with the project manager on scope, budget, and timelines. The feedback from the client was positive, highlighting her ability to absorb information quickly and efficiently, reducing the need for many revisions.
In another project, Cheryl was hired by a community foundation in Vancouver to design a holiday e-card for their donors. Cheryl was chosen for her diverse and playful design style, which was in line with the brand's image. The project involved a discovery call to discuss potential design options, after which Cheryl provided a mock-up. After one round of revisions, the e-card was ready for use. The client was impressed with Cheryl's work and has since worked with her on other projects.
Cheryl also worked with a crown corporation based in Vancouver, creating infographics and illustrations for both internal and external audiences. She was chosen for her creative design skills and ability to deliver the desired look and feel. Each project started with a creative brief, followed by Cheryl providing a detailed estimate and timeline. The feedback from the client was positive, with the first iteration of her work usually aligning with what they had envisioned. Cheryl's ability to tweak design elements to align with the project's needs was also appreciated.
